What Are Residential Treatment Centers for Troubled Teen Girls From Lyons, CO?

Residential treatment centers (RTC's) for struggling teenage girls from Lyons, CO are technoscientific treatment programs that offer a wide array of concentrated live-in psychotherapeutic and behavioral treatments to troubled teenage girls from all over the US., including teens from the Lyons, CO area. These institutions are similar to recovery centers, except they offer a fully approved academic curriculum for their junior and high school-aged sufferers.


Any RTC deemed a credible treatment program applies a varying number of psychiatric and behavioral experts -- the specific number depends on the size of the campus and the fraction of teens living on campus.  

The most important characteristic of an RTC is its level of concentrated care and 24-hour surveillance. This 24-hour level of observation, first and foremost, is for the child's safety. Notwithstanding, it also minimizes the chance of a teenager running away and gives them with an uninterrupted environment where they are more inclined to be receptive to treatment and restoration. Residential treatment is also listed as a long-term program challenging students to live for extended periods -- typically nine-to-sixteen months. 

Another trademark feature of a top-tier residential treatment program (including those near Lyons, CO) is its range of therapies. According to behavioral professionals, residential programs should present each teenage occupant on their campus with an individual, utterly individualized therapy program that is individually tailored to suit their personal academic, therapeutic, and behavioral requirements. What Type of Issues are Residential Treatment Programs Designed to Treat?

A residential treatment program aims to provide expert behavioral and psychiatric help to troubled adolescents who necessitate intensive support in defeating their adverse and self-sabotaging ways. These intensive long-term arrangements also address, diagnose, and treat the underlying problems that cause said issues to occur, thus treating the rooted cause rather than the superficial behaviors.

 RTC's are constructed for teens whose out-of-control actions and mental health-related issues require more concentrated modes of therapy than traditional, short-term, and outpatient options can accommodate.

Why is Family Involvement Important?

When a teenager's day-to-day decision-making becomes unmanageable, and their life spirals out of control, it affects the entire family unit and puts a strain on the family as a whole.

Therefore, family participation should be a key part of every troubled girls' rehabilitation. Without the involvement of their family members, girls from Lyons, CO are significantly less likely to achieve any long-lasting changes.
